TEAM SPOTLIGHT
The Order was founded by me, Torak. I was a young manager who had great
ambitions and dreams. I started out with a team that I called the "Dark Dragons." I
had such high hopes for that team, but that which was my dream was taken from me in
my travels between arenas. My whole team was slaughtered. I thought that I was
dead, and I guess, so did my assailant.
I was found later by a beautiful, yet fierce-looking, woman who called herself
Anastrianna. She nursed me back to health, and along with the aid of her cousin,
Jasker, I was able to find myself again. Both of these individuals are fierce
warriors who lost their families to raids. I don't know what they saw in me, but it
convinced them to leave their home to help me build another team.
Along my travels, I met a couple of very respectable people: Tokec of the
Silver Knights, and the Expatriot of the Bleak Legion. I learned a great deal from
these two men. They gave me the courage and guidance I needed to continue on.
Another very respectable person that I have to visit each time I come to Fratsfa is
the very lovely Lady Fern. The Flower Shoppe is definitely on my favorites list.
With the cousins, Anastrianna and Jasker, I journeyed on; later adding Lankus
and Krull to the roster. We met a part-time member named Kozak, who proved to be
just that: part-time. Making my way back to the great Fratsfa arena, I learned of
the chaos that is rocking the world of Alastari. I was both angered and amazed at
everything that was going on.
I decided that, with the help of my team, I was going to try to bring order to a
world full of chaos. In this quest, I have named Jasker as my scout and Anastrianna
as my champion. After much arguing over what we would call ourselves and many weeks
of healing, it was the lovely Anastrianna who simply said, "Order." After looking
dumbfounded for a moment, I smiled. Since then, we were simply that, The Order, and
we will bring that to the world.
-- Torak
+ ]H[ + ---:--- + ]H[ The Andorian Succession #34 ]H[ + ---:--- + ]H[ +
Fratsfa, more or less:
"We have to get out of here now," Lenpro said, urging Sizzling Sunflower toward
the gate of this arena. "Even if we can't find the portal to take us back to the
true Fratsfa--"
"Will they let us go?" the Lady Protector asked. She glanced to the side and
saw that Lenpro had his own sword out. Oddly, she'd never thought of him as being a
warrior--he was so old! But he managed gladiators, trained them, and he'd lived a
long time in a world where violence was not uncommon.
"Can they stop us, except by magic?" the manager asked. "And I have a feeling
their half-demon mage will be busy trying to keep control of things now that you've
beaten his--I think the vampire was his enforcer."
"I don't know for certain that the vampire's dead," Sunflower warned. "They're
tricky to kill."
"Doesn't matter," the manager said, steering her to her right. They hurried
down another street, not running, because if you ran, there was always something or
someone who would automatically give chase. "Even if it isn't dead, or what passes
for dead among vampires, it was hurt and won't be up to giving us trouble before we
can get out of here." He swerved to the left into an alley, and she followed.
"Do you know where we're going?" Sunflower asked. "Not that I care much at the
moment, as long as it's 'away'."
"I've got a good idea which way the Portal lies," Lenpro said. "Fandil is the
magician in the family, but there are other kinds of skills."
"If you can find and open the Portal back to Fratsfa--"
"I can find it," Lenpro said. "I'm nearly certain I can find it. But opening
it might present problems. Unless there's someone on hand who can be coerced. I do
coercion from time to time."
"Good. So do I."
They turned another corner, and Lenpro pointed ahead. An archway of mismatched
stones straddled the way ahead of them, framing grayness. "There's our portal," he
said.
Andor:
Outcast Orchid stared back toward the avenue and the slaughter of the "king" by
out-of-work gladiators. "I don't believe it! Those gladiators were waiting to kill
the king--the golem they thought was the king. How could they do such a thing?"
"You saw how," the man beside her said.
"Yes, but--"
"Gladiators come all kinds, just like ordinary people," he went on. "Some good,
some bad, and a lot of them on the fence. And this hasn't been a good town for a
gladiator since the arena closed. They were probably so glad to have a job that they
didn't look into it closely."
"You're saying someone paid them to--?"
"Of course." He steered her into an alley just before a troop of mounted guards
rushed past. "Very few people, gladiators or not, are genuine anarchists to kill
what they believe is the king just for... kicks." He paused at the other end of the
alley, looked both ways, and hurried her across another street into an overgrown
park.
"But they must have expected the guards, why didn't they have an escape route
ready?"
"They were most likely told the guards wouldn't be a problem. Don't you see?"
He stopped and turned to face her. "They were set up to kill and to die." He shook
her a little. "Believe it, lady! Lord Korneth doesn't care whose death he ordered,
and you will be a target if anyone noticed and recognized you. Even if no one saw
you at the parade--any gladiator found in Andor today will be marked for death. You
have to get out of the city!"
"And so do you," she answered. "You helped me get away, and someone will have
noticed--someone always notices."
"My life is already forfeit. Gods forgive me, I've been a part of this. But
they will not find my death easily achieved, and that may buy you extra time to
escape--"
"If you want to make amends for whatever it is you've done, better to help FIX
things than just throw your life away," Orchid argued. She glanced around, orienting
herself. "Fratsfa's THAT way." She set out, keeping a firm grip on her companion's
arm. "Come ON."
"Lady--"
"Don't waste time and breath arguing," she said. "Just come ON. When we get
out of the city, THEN we can argue."
West of Fratsfa:
Elosjon glanced over his shoulder as they left the deserted buildings of
Mountain Home behind them. He had been thrilled when a well-known, deeply respected
magician like Fandil of Ardivent had invited him to help, but the idea of facing a
demonic 'watchdog' chilled him to the bone. He was not skilled enough to deal with
demons, and he knew it. He just didn't want to have to admit it to a master of his
profession. He took a deep breath, coughed at the bite of sulfur in the air, and
squared his shoulders. He would do his best. Surely an experienced magician like
Fandil would understand that his best was all he could do.
But he hoped they wouldn't meet that demonic watchdog.
His mind was so fixed on what he hoped that he didn't notice where he was going
and ran full into Fandil. The old magician was standing in the middle of the
overgrown road, immobile as a tree, staring up the mountain. Elosjon followed the
direction of his gaze.
Fandil was looking at the castle on the ridge above what had been the town.
Studying it. Okay. Elosjon studied it, too. He had only seen it once before, a
long time ago, when he was a kid--well, that might not seem long to someone like
Fandil, but it was a long time ago to him. He didn't remember it clearly. At least,
he didn't remember it looking quite like this. He frowned, trying to figure out what
was different... or wrong. It was a fairly standard Medieval Frafrejan castle.
Central keep, enclosing wall with a lot of pointy little towers along it.... Wasn't
that wall leaning outward a little too much? It looked like a stone wave about to
break over their heads. In fact, for a structure that was at least half a mile away
horizontally, maybe a little farther vertically, it seemed to be looming very much
over their heads. Enough that it would be no surprise if it blocked out the sun.
That had to be a magical effect, didn't it? Even though he'd never heard of one like
that.
"Our enemy is powerful, and heedless of normal safety," Fandil said. His voice
was quiet. "That heedlessness makes him doubly dangerous. And it is crucial that he
be destroyed, or he will destroy not only us, not only the Andorian League, but a
goodly portion of this whole area." The old mage's voice hardened. "He is dabbling
on the edges of Chaos magic."
Elosjon paled. He had traveled some in Alastari as part of his education in
magic, had seen the Smoking Plain near Delarq Tor that was all that remained of a
fertile and populous countryside that had been hit with a blast of Chaos magic five
hundred years ago during the last Chaos War. And he had heard of the Twisted Lands
farther south, where the Chaos War of three and a half millennia ago had centered.
And now someone would do it here? "No! We can't allow that--anything we can do, I
would give my life if that would stop him--" He started up the road to the castle.
Fandil caught his arm. "You may end up doing that, and I may also, but we will
not succeed by rushing straight ahead. This calls for planning and finesse."
